Thermal Cutoffs, also known as thermal fuses, are an electronic safety device that trips or opens to interrupt current flow once a predetermined temperature is exceeded. The EYP-2BN109 is an example of this type of device. This thermal cutoff works to protect both appliances and electrical wiring from hazardous operating conditions.
